Bug 216415

Summary: ark decompressing tar.bz2 file
Product: [Applications] ark Reporter: thesimsone
Component: generalAssignee: Harald Hvaal <metellius>
Status: RESOLVED DUPLICATE    
Severity: crash CC: rakuco
Priority: NOR    
Version: unspecified   
Target Milestone: ---   
Platform: Unlisted Binaries   
OS: Linux   
Latest Commit: Version Fixed In:
Sentry Crash Report:

Description thesimsone 2009-11-27 19:16:06 UTC
Application that crashed: ark
Version of the application: 2.13
KDE Version: 4.3.2 (KDE 4.3.2)
Qt Version: 4.5.2
Operating System: Linux 2.6.31-14-generic i686
Distribution: Ubuntu 9.10

What I was doing when the application crashed:
another example with useful debuging informations

 -- Backtrace:
Application: Ark (ark), signal: Aborted
[Current thread is 1 (Thread 0xb7812700 (LWP 6534))]

Thread 2 (Thread 0xb5f0db70 (LWP 6535)):
[KCrash Handler]
#6  0x00274422 in __kernel_vsyscall ()
#7  0x06dda4d1 in raise () from /lib/tls/i686/cmov/libc.so.6
#8  0x06ddd932 in abort () from /lib/tls/i686/cmov/libc.so.6
#9  0x06e10ee5 in ?? () from /lib/tls/i686/cmov/libc.so.6
#10 0x06e1aff1 in ?? () from /lib/tls/i686/cmov/libc.so.6
#11 0x06e1e3bb in ?? () from /lib/tls/i686/cmov/libc.so.6
#12 0x06e20319 in ?? () from /lib/tls/i686/cmov/libc.so.6
#13 0x06e2082d in realloc () from /lib/tls/i686/cmov/libc.so.6
#14 0x055aa664 in qRealloc (ptr=0x9fd1a38, size=32) at global/qmalloc.cpp:65
#15 0x055d47e5 in QListData::realloc (this=0xb5f0cf3c, alloc=3) at tools/qlistdata.cpp:111
#16 0x055d4a24 in QListData::append (this=0xb5f0cf3c) at tools/qlistdata.cpp:131
#17 0x055b762c in QList<QByteArray>::append (this=0xb5f0cf3c, t=...) at ../../include/QtCore/../../src/corelib/tools/qlist.h:429
#18 0x056a746d in QList<QByteArray>::operator+= (this=0xb5f0cf34) at ../../include/QtCore/../../src/corelib/tools/qlist.h:302
#19 QMetaMethod::parameterTypes (this=0xb5f0cf34) at kernel/qmetaobject.cpp:1252
#20 0x056b1473 in queued_activate (sender=<value optimized out>, signal=<value optimized out>, c=..., argv=0xb5f0d028, semaphore=0x0) at kernel/qobject.cpp:2990
#21 0x056b6187 in QMetaObject::activate (sender=0x9f50c18, from_signal_index=28, to_signal_index=28, argv=0xb5f0d028) at kernel/qobject.cpp:3086
#22 0x056b6ec2 in QMetaObject::activate (sender=0x9f50c18, m=0xb5412c, local_signal_index=2, argv=0xb5f0d028) at kernel/qobject.cpp:3187
#23 0x00b33c13 in Kerfuffle::Job::newEntry (this=0x9f50c18, _t1=...) at ./jobs.moc:107
#24 0x00b33c54 in Kerfuffle::Job::onEntry (this=0x9f50c18, archiveEntry=...) at ../../../ark/kerfuffle/jobs.cpp:85
#25 0x00b3394b in Kerfuffle::ReadOnlyArchiveInterface::entry (this=0x9f52978, archiveEntry=...) at ../../../ark/kerfuffle/archiveinterface.cpp:81
#26 0x079e0821 in LibArchiveInterface::emitEntryFromArchiveEntry (this=0x9f52978, aentry=0x9fd9b88) at ../../../../ark/plugins/libarchive/libarchivehandler.cpp:577
#27 0x079e0dbf in LibArchiveInterface::list (this=0x9f52978) at ../../../../ark/plugins/libarchive/libarchivehandler.cpp:85
#28 0x00b34a45 in Kerfuffle::ListJob::doWork (this=0x9f50c18) at ../../../ark/kerfuffle/jobs.cpp:144
#29 0x00b380a2 in Kerfuffle::ThreadExecution::run (this=0x9e4b2b8) at ../../../ark/kerfuffle/threading.cpp:41
#30 0x055afe32 in QThreadPrivate::start (arg=0x9e4b2b8) at thread/qthread_unix.cpp:188
#31 0x05a9c80e in start_thread () from /lib/tls/i686/cmov/libpthread.so.0
#32 0x06e7c7ee in clone () from /lib/tls/i686/cmov/libc.so.6

Thread 1 (Thread 0xb7812700 (LWP 6534)):
#0  0x00274422 in __kernel_vsyscall ()
#1  0x05aa0e15 in pthread_cond_wait@@GLIBC_2.3.2 () from /lib/tls/i686/cmov/libpthread.so.0
#2  0x06e8978d in pthread_cond_wait () from /lib/tls/i686/cmov/libc.so.6
#3  0x055b0e67 in QWaitConditionPrivate::wait (this=0x9fd78a8, mutex=0x9fd7894, time=4294967295) at thread/qwaitcondition_unix.cpp:87
#4  QWaitCondition::wait (this=0x9fd78a8, mutex=0x9fd7894, time=4294967295) at thread/qwaitcondition_unix.cpp:159
#5  0x055afec9 in QThread::wait (this=0x9e4b2b8, time=4294967295) at thread/qthread_unix.cpp:484
#6  0x00b3436a in ~Job (this=0x9f50c18, __in_chrg=<value optimized out>) at ../../../ark/kerfuffle/jobs.cpp:59
#7  0x00b37c3f in ~ListJob (this=0x9f50c18, __in_chrg=<value optimized out>) at ../../../ark/kerfuffle/jobs.h:82
#8  0x056af46f in QObjectPrivate::deleteChildren (this=0x9fd5340) at kernel/qobject.cpp:1847
#9  0x056b77cf in ~QObject (this=0x9f50a60, __in_chrg=<value optimized out>) at kernel/qobject.cpp:836
#10 0x00b389c9 in ~ArchiveBase (this=0x9f50a60, __in_chrg=<value optimized out>) at ../../../ark/kerfuffle/archivebase.cpp:55
#11 0x07a6215d in ~ArchiveModel (this=0x9e2d520, __in_chrg=<value optimized out>) at ../../../ark/part/archivemodel.cpp:195
#12 0x056af46f in QObjectPrivate::deleteChildren (this=0x9e47660) at kernel/qobject.cpp:1847
#13 0x056b77cf in ~QObject (this=0x9e27a50, __in_chrg=<value optimized out>) at kernel/qobject.cpp:836
#14 0x001f2d65 in ~Part (this=0x9e27a50, __vtt_parm=0x7a723ec, __in_chrg=<value optimized out>) at ../../kparts/part.cpp:212
#15 0x001f333a in ~ReadOnlyPart (this=0x9e27a50, __vtt_parm=0x7a723e8, __in_chrg=<value optimized out>) at ../../kparts/part.cpp:459
#16 0x001f349f in ~ReadWritePart (this=0x9e27a50, __vtt_parm=0x7a723e4, __in_chrg=<value optimized out>) at ../../kparts/part.cpp:721
#17 0x07a539e3 in ~Part (this=0x9e27a50, __in_chrg=<value optimized out>, __vtt_parm=<value optimized out>) at ../../../ark/part/part.cpp:115
#18 0x08051467 in ~MainWindow (this=0x9e0eb00, __in_chrg=<value optimized out>, __vtt_parm=<value optimized out>) at ../../../ark/app/mainwindow.cpp:73
#19 0x056af135 in qDeleteInEventHandler (o=0xfffffe00) at kernel/qobject.cpp:3815
#20 0x056b062b in QObject::event (this=0x9e0eb00, e=0xb504afd0) at kernel/qobject.cpp:1094
#21 0x00ccb906 in QWidget::event (this=0x9e0eb00, event=0xb504afd0) at kernel/qwidget.cpp:7946
#22 0x01099297 in QMainWindow::event (this=0x9e0eb00, event=0xb504afd0) at widgets/qmainwindow.cpp:1399
#23 0x0052ddc4 in KMainWindow::event (this=0x9e0eb00, ev=0xb504afd0) at ../../kdeui/widgets/kmainwindow.cpp:1094
#24 0x0057430f in KXmlGuiWindow::event (this=0x9e0eb00, ev=0xb504afd0) at ../../kdeui/xmlgui/kxmlguiwindow.cpp:131
#25 0x00c76f54 in QApplicationPrivate::notify_helper (this=0x9d68938, receiver=0x9e0eb00, e=0xb504afd0) at kernel/qapplication.cpp:4056
#26 0x00c7e5ca in QApplication::notify (this=0xbff0f300, receiver=0x9e0eb00, e=0xb504afd0) at kernel/qapplication.cpp:4021
#27 0x00447bfa in KApplication::notify (this=0xbff0f300, receiver=0x9e0eb00, event=0xb504afd0) at ../../kdeui/kernel/kapplication.cpp:302
#28 0x056a06cb in QCoreApplication::notifyInternal (this=0xbff0f300, receiver=0x9e0eb00, event=0xb504afd0) at kernel/qcoreapplication.cpp:610
#29 0x056a12b2 in QCoreApplication::sendEvent (receiver=0x0, event_type=0, data=0x9d51800) at ../../include/QtCore/../../src/corelib/kernel/qcoreapplication.h:213
#30 QCoreApplicationPrivate::sendPostedEvents (receiver=0x0, event_type=0, data=0x9d51800) at kernel/qcoreapplication.cpp:1247
#31 0x056a147d in QCoreApplication::sendPostedEvents (receiver=0x0, event_type=0) at kernel/qcoreapplication.cpp:1140
#32 0x056cb3ff in QCoreApplication::sendPostedEvents (s=0x9d6a388) at ../../include/QtCore/../../src/corelib/kernel/qcoreapplication.h:218
#33 postEventSourceDispatch (s=0x9d6a388) at kernel/qeventdispatcher_glib.cpp:210
#34 0x0156ae78 in g_main_context_dispatch () from /lib/libglib-2.0.so.0
#35 0x0156e720 in ?? () from /lib/libglib-2.0.so.0
#36 0x0156e853 in g_main_context_iteration () from /lib/libglib-2.0.so.0
#37 0x056cb02c in QEventDispatcherGlib::processEvents (this=0x9d519d8, flags=...) at kernel/qeventdispatcher_glib.cpp:327
#38 0x00d17be5 in QGuiEventDispatcherGlib::processEvents (this=0x9d519d8, flags=...) at kernel/qguieventdispatcher_glib.cpp:202
#39 0x0569ec79 in QEventLoop::processEvents (this=0xbff0f264, flags=) at kernel/qeventloop.cpp:149
#40 0x0569f0ca in QEventLoop::exec (this=0xbff0f264, flags=...) at kernel/qeventloop.cpp:201
#41 0x056a153f in QCoreApplication::exec () at kernel/qcoreapplication.cpp:888
#42 0x00c76dd7 in QApplication::exec () at kernel/qapplication.cpp:3525
#43 0x08050184 in main (argc=4, argv=0xbff0f6b4) at ../../../ark/app/main.cpp:209

Reported using DrKonqi
Comment 1 Raphael Kubo da Costa 2009-11-27 19:22:48 UTC
Were you still loading the document when you tried to close Ark?
Comment 2 thesimsone 2009-11-27 21:57:49 UTC
yes I closed Ark while a loading
Comment 3 thesimsone 2009-11-27 22:01:10 UTC
After doing a test I can make the bug again by closing Ark while a loading. It seems that it is what makes Ark bugging.
Comment 4 Raphael Kubo da Costa 2009-11-27 22:38:37 UTC
Thanks for the information. Closing as a duplicate.

*** This bug has been marked as a duplicate of bug 193908 ***